Ingredient Breakdown
To create the mouthwatering Cheesy Ranch Roasted Potatoes with Smoked Sausage, you’ll need a harmonious blend of ingredients that enrich the dish with flavor and texture. Here’s a closer look at what you’ll require:
- 1 lb smoked sausage: Sliced into 1/4-inch rounds. The inclusion of smoked sausage not only adds protein but also enhances the flavor profile with its robust and smoky essence, making every bite more exciting.
- 4 cups baby potatoes: Halved or quartered, depending on size. Baby potatoes offer a tender texture when roasted and absorb the flavors of surrounding ingredients. You can use different varieties like red, yellow, or a medley for visual appeal.
- 2 tbsp olive oil: Essential for roasting, olive oil helps to achieve that irresistible crispiness while adding its rich flavor.
- 1 packet ranch seasoning: A vital component, ranch seasoning infuses the dish with a creamy, herbaceous flavor that complements the other ingredients beautifully.
- 1 tsp garlic powder: This brings an additional layer of savory flavor, enhancing the overall taste of the dish.
- 1 tsp onion powder: Like garlic powder, onion powder adds depth to the flavor without overpowering the dish.
- 1/2 tsp black pepper: A pinch of black pepper adds a subtle heat that elevates the dish’s flavor profile.
- 1 1/2 cups shredded cheddar cheese: Choosing a good quality cheddar cheese will provide a rich and melty texture that combines beautifully with the other ingredients.
- Sour cream: Optional for serving. A dollop of sour cream can add a tangy creaminess that rounds out the dish perfectly.
- Fresh chopped parsley: Optional for garnish. Chopped parsley adds a touch of color and freshness to your presentation.

Step-by-Step Instructions
Now that you’ve gathered your ingredients, it’s time to prepare your Cheesy Ranch Roasted Potatoes with Smoked Sausage. Follow these easy steps:
1. Preheat the Oven
Start by preheating your oven to 400°F (200°C). A properly heated oven ensures your potatoes get that lovely crispiness.
2. Prep the Potatoes
Give your baby potatoes a good wash to remove any dirt, then cut them in half or quarters based on their size. This ensures they cook evenly and allows them to absorb the flavors more effectively.
3. Slice the Sausage
Next, take your smoked sausage and slice it into 1/4-inch thick rounds. The size allows for quick cooking, ensuring you get those beautifully browned edges.
4. Mix the Seasonings
In a small bowl, combine the ranch seasoning, garlic powder, onion powder, and black pepper. This mixture will be the heart of your flavor profile.
5. Season Everything
In a large bowl, toss the cut potatoes and sausage with the olive oil until well-coated. Then add the seasoning mixture and mix until everything is evenly coated. This step is crucial for infusing flavor throughout the dish.
6. Roast the Mixture
Spread the seasoned potatoes and sausage on a baking sheet in a single layer. Roast in the oven for 35 to 40 minutes. Be sure to stir halfway through for even cooking, until the potatoes are golden and tender.
7. Add the Cheese
Once the roasting is complete, sprinkle the shredded cheddar cheese over the hot potatoes and sausage. Return the pan to the oven and bake for an additional 5 minutes until the cheese is gooey and bubbly.
8. Serve and Enjoy
Garnish your Cheesy Ranch Roasted Potatoes with fresh parsley and serve with a dollop of sour cream if you like. It’s time to dig in and enjoy this delightful dish!

Tips for Perfecting Your Cheesy Ranch Roasted Potatoes
Here are some handy tips to ensure your Cheesy Ranch Roasted Potatoes with Smoked Sausage come out just right every time:
- Choosing the Right Potatoes: Opt for waxy varieties like Yukon Gold or red potatoes, as they hold their shape well when roasted.
- Enhancing Flavor with Herbs and Spices: Don’t hesitate to add fresh herbs like thyme or rosemary for an aromatic touch.
- Importance of Even Cutting: Make sure your potatoes and sausage slices are cut evenly to facilitate uniform cooking.
- Adjusting Cooking Time: Oven temperatures can vary, so keep an eye on your potatoes towards the end of the cooking time.

Storage and Reheating Tips
Proper storage and reheating methods allow you to enjoy leftovers of Cheesy Ranch Roasted Potatoes with Smoked Sausage:
- How to Store Leftovers: Allow your roasted mixture to cool completely before transferring it to an airtight container. Refrigerate for up to 3 days.
- Best Practices for Reheating: Use the oven to reheat at 350°F (175°C) for about 15-20 minutes, or microwave in intervals stirring often to avoid sogginess.

FAQs
- Can I use frozen potatoes for Cheesy Ranch Roasted Potatoes? Yes, you can use frozen potatoes for this recipe, but there are a few adjustments to consider. Frozen potatoes are typically pre-cooked, so they will require less roasting time than fresh potatoes. Spread them out on the baking sheet in a single layer and roast at 400°F (200°C) for about 20-30 minutes, stirring halfway through. Keep an eye on them to ensure they don’t overcook and become mushy. Additionally, you may want to adjust the seasoning since frozen varieties can sometimes come pre-seasoned.
- How can I make Cheesy Ranch Roasted Potatoes spicier? To add some heat to your Cheesy Ranch Roasted Potatoes, consider mixing in some spicy seasonings or ingredients. You can add cayenne pepper or crushed red pepper flakes to the seasoning mix for a kick. Another option is to use a spicy ranch dressing or a spicier sausage, such as andouille. You might also stir in some diced jalapeños or use pepper jack cheese instead of regular cheddar for an extra layer of heat.

- How do I adjust the recipe for different cooking methods, like using an air fryer? To adapt the Cheesy Ranch Roasted Potatoes recipe for an air fryer, start by tossing the prepared potatoes and sausage with olive oil and seasonings as you would for roasting. Preheat the air fryer to 375°F (190°C). Place the mixture in the air fryer basket in a single layer, avoiding overcrowding for even cooking. Cook for about 15-20 minutes, shaking the basket halfway through for even browning. Add the cheese during the last few minutes of cooking to allow it to melt.
